Up to 40 kW from air-to-water heat pumps

Heating outputs of up to 40 kW are available from a new range of air-to-water heat pumps from Ciat Ozonair.
Ciat Ozonair has introduced a range of air-to-water heat pumps with capacities of up to 40 kW. Control of the air flow and the use of a single compressor with continuous capacity control reduce the footprint of Aquaciat Grand Inverter units by up to 35% and also reduce noise levels. Features include rapid start-up to eliminate short on/off cycles, resulting in a more constant water temperature, longer service life, reduced maintenance and greater comfort.
